In 1 Chronicles 22-29, we read of David, unable to build a house for the Lord, doing extensive planning and preparation for Solomon to build the Temple. David had this thing organized from the materials to the musicians to the gatekeepers. Out of love and reverence, David thoroughly thought out each step and process, each instrument and design. He gave His best. He deliberately set things in motion for the worship and work of the Temple. He worshiped God!
God is challenging me through these passages...am I giving my best? Am I being cavalier in my preparation to worship? Am I pursuing excellence in the gifts God has given me? Am I worshiping?
